...wash your feet if you like





…a tempayan (earthenware jar) full of rain water was always present near the steps up to a malay kampung (village) house raised on wooden columns…a coconut shell was provided as scoop so you could wash your feet before going up to the entrance porch

drawing by lim jee yuan

proceeding to the long and narrow verandah, the first area that greets a visitor ...

the swiss army knife of asian brooms




…this is penyapu lidi (coconut-frond broom) which was, once upon a time, a very common item in malay households in malaysia
…it’s very versatile: a fly swatter, a cleaning utensil for hard-to-reach cobwebs in the ceilings, a mean of controlling recalcitrant animals, if waved in the direction of a person was the lowest form of insult…the spread of the utility bottom part is adjusted by twisting the handle bunch…and if chopped a foot from the handle becomes a very robust brush…and if a 6 foot-long pole is inserted in the handle, it becomes a sweeper a council worker use to tidy up roads with...


…this particular one was bought from the cobargo visitors centre, as you do at a tourist info stop, here at the south coast…
